In FY FY2022, Oregon State University filed 89 H-1B petitions with an average salary of $76k. Top positions include Assistant Professor (26%), Postdoctoral Scholar (17%), Research Associate (12%). Filings were concentrated in Oregon (98%), Virginia (1%), Washington (1%). The certification rate was 100%. Salaries ranged from $36k to $177k.
| Percentile |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th | $36k |
| 25th | $55k |
| 50th (Median) | $66k |
| 75th | $94k |
| 90th | $111k |
Based on 89 salary records. Range: $36k – $177k.
90% of filings offer salaries above the prevailing wage, with an average premium of 30.2%. The average prevailing wage is $58k (based on 89 filings).
Average processing time is 8 days (median: 7 days). Fastest: 7 days, slowest: 48 days. Based on 89 filings.
74% of filings are for new positions, while 17% are for continued employment (89 filings).
Average contract duration: 34 months (median: 36 months), based on 89 filings.
